Nothing says "happy Fourth" like a red, white, and blue popsicle from an ice cream truck dripping down your hand. And because Taylor Swift is the unofficial queen of July 4th, the Speak Now songstress did just that.

While celebrating the holiday—at her annual Fourth of July bash, of course—Swift shared an iconic Bomb Pop with her bestie, Selena Gomez.

"Happy belated Independence Day from your local neighborhood independent girlies 😎," she wrote on Instagram, just hours after releasing her latest album re-record, Speak Now (Taylor's Version).

In another pic shared in her Instagram carousel, Swift stuck her tongue out alongside several bikini-clad pals. Este, Alana, and Danielle Haim were there, alongside Taylor's longtime friend Ashley Avignone and her brother's reported girlfriend, Sydney Ness.

Taylor has long been known for her Independence Day parties, which often take place at her humble (read: not humble at all, it's a beachfront mansion) Rhode Island home and are brimming with celebs like Blake Lively, Ryan Reynolds, Gigi Hadid, and Cara Delevingne.

And while, sure, "Taymerica" 2023 (her branding, not mine) was a bit more low-key than in years past, at least Swift is back to her roots: throwing the red, white, and blue bash.
